Tenaculum Forceps:
-
Purpose: Used to grasp and hold tissue securely during surgical procedures
-
Design: Feature sharp, pointed hooks at the tips for firm penetration and grip
-
Function: Provide strong and stable control of tissues, minimizing slippage
-
Common Use: Frequently used in gynecological, vascular, and general surgeries
-
Surgical Role: Assist in manipulating or stabilizing organs, vessels, or other tissues
-
Material: Typically made of stainless steel for durability and sterilization
-
Precision: Enhance surgical accuracy by allowing controlled tissue handling
